logo

Output 038fefdfbc77566dae84d0b2ee2a72ac9b850cc793fb121e36d98f1d877eb715:0

value
505963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882049c1cd17129d5e1ee1dc5571f26c4afd33fd OP_EQUAL
address
3E6nW3rvnajFMWxnfwQ48nACac9nqVus8V
transaction
038fefdfbc77566dae84d0b2ee2a72ac9b850cc793fb121e36d98f1d877eb715